Smoky Chili
Smoky Chili can be made with ground beef or venison that is slightly sweet with a smoky kick and just enough heat.

- 1 1/2 pounds lean ground beef or venison
- 1/4 cup steak rub or all purpose seasoning
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 large onions diced
- 2 slices thick cut bacon diced
- 4 ounces green chiles
- 1 carrot grated
- 6 cups V8 juice
- 16 ounce can pinto beans rinsed and drained
- 14. ounce can diced tomatoes
- 1 cup chili seasoning
- Shredded cheese for serving cheddar, colby jack or pepper jack
- Sour cream for serving
- Candied Jalapeños for serving
- Fritos for serving
Mix ground beef or venison with steak rub.
Press onto a grill pan in a thin layer or add to a skillet.
Grill over direct fire until cooked through or reaches 165°. If cooking in a skillet, cook until well browned.
Meanwhile, add olive oil to a dutch oven or large soup pan. Add dice bacon and onions, cooking over medium heat, stirring occasionally until onions are softened.
Add green chiles and carrot. Continue cooking, stirring occasionally cooking 10 minutes.
Stir in the V8 Juice, diced tomatoes and pinto beans.
If ground meat is grilled, chop coarsely. Add to the pan along with the chili seasoning. Stir to combine. Lower to simmer and cook for 30 minutes.
Remove from heat and serve with desired toppings.
Make it Spicy: Add 1- 2 teaspoons cayenne pepper or diced jalapeños for spicy chili.
Storage: Store leftover chili in a covered bowl in the refrigerator up to 4 days.
Freeze: Place in a zip to freezer bag and freeze up to 3 months. Thaw in refrigerator before reheating.
Reheat: Place chili in a pan with a bit of V8 juice or water and cook over medium heat, stirring occasionally until heated through.
